  • Abstract
    An academic database and counseling system (ADCS) is described which has been designed to meet the growing problems of maintaining students´ academic records and to facilitate advising them. This package, written in C for IBM PCs and their compatibles, maintains students´ college history, computes their GPAs and total credit hours earned, determines their classifications and status, and advises them on which courses to take the next term. Even though this system is designed for the electrical engineering program of the University of Florida, the system is flexible enough to allow the user to change the degree requirements, which makes it adaptable to any other academic program
